Lakeville to Thief River Falls is 318.1 miles and takes about 6h 13m via US 10, US 59, and I 94, with a fuel budget near $48 and enough daylight to finish in a day. This trip stays within Minnesota, traversing the Midwest region. You'll find it's a predominantly highway drive, making it a straightforward option for a single-day journey. Consider this route if you're looking for efficiency and a clear path across the state.

This drive is almost entirely on highways, with a 96% highway share. You'll experience a lengthy stretch of 156.7 miles on US 10, offering a consistent cruising experience. The transition from highway to surface roads will be minimal, as you'll spend most of your time navigating major thoroughfares. Expect straightforward driving with fewer complex intersections.
This is a straightforward highway drive that stays mostly on US 10 and US 59. This route has several spots where lane changes, forks, or exits need your full attention. The trickiest moment comes around 4.5 miles in.
